What Is CNC Machining and Why Does Precision Matter?

CNC (Computer Numerical Control) machining is a subtractive manufacturing process where pre-programmed computer software dictates the movement of factory tools and machinery. The process can control a range of complex machinery, from grinders and lathes to mills and routers, enabling the production of parts with extremely tight tolerances and complex geometries.

Precision in CNC machining isn’t just a technical specification—it’s a critical enabler of performance, safety, and innovation. In industries such as aerospace, medical, robotics, and electronics, even a deviation of a few microns can lead to functional failure, safety risks, or costly recalls. That’s why choosing a machining partner that consistently delivers high precision, superior surface finish, and reliable repeatability is non-negotiable.

The Challenges in Finding an Excellent CNC Machining Service

Many businesses, especially SMEs, startups, and R&D teams, face several hurdles when sourcing CNC machining services:

图片

🔍 1. Inconsistent Quality Claims

Some vendors advertise “±0.001mm precision” but fail to deliver consistent results across batches or larger production volumes.

🛠️ 2. Limited Capabilities

Not all shops have the equipment or expertise to handle complex geometries, hard metals, or multi-axis machining requirements.

⏱️ 3. Long Lead Times

Without sufficient capacity or optimized workflows, lead times can stretch from days to weeks, delaying your time-to-market.

🧩 4. Poor Post-Processing Options

Finishing services like anodizing, polishing, plating, or heat treatment are often outsourced, leading to miscommunication and quality loss.

📜 5. Lack of Certifications & Traceability

For regulated industries (medical, aerospace, automotive), certifications like ISO 9001, IATF 16949, or ISO 13485 are essential—but not all suppliers comply.

This finishing option with the shortest turnaround time. Parts have visible tool marks and potentially sharp edges and burrs, which can be removed upon request.
Sand blasting uses pressurized sand or other media to clean and texture the surface, creating a uniform, matte finish.
Polishing is the process of creating a smooth and shiny surface by rubbing it or by applying a chemical treatmen
A brushed finish creates a unidirectional satin texture, reducing the visibility of marks and scratches on the surface.
Anodizing increases corrosion resistance and wear properties, while allowing for color dyeing, ideal for aluminum parts.
Black oxide is a conversion coating that is used on steels to improve corrosion resistance and minimize light reflection.
Electroplating bonds a thin metal layer onto parts, improving wear resistance, corrosion resistance, and surface conductivity.
This is a finish of applying powdered paint to the components and then baking it in an oven, which results in a stronger, more wear- and corrosion-resistant layer that is more durable than traditional painting methods.

IATF 16949 certificate

IATF 16949 is an internationally recognized Quality Management System (QMS) standard specifically for the automotive industry and engine hardware parts production quality management system certification. It is based on ISO 9001 and adds specific requirements related to the production and service of automotive and engine hardware parts. Its goal is to improve quality, streamline processes, and reduce variation and waste in the automotive and engine hardware parts supply chain.

ISO 27001 certificate

ISO/IEC 27001 is an international standard for managing and processing information security. This standard is jointly developed by the International Organization for Standardization (ISO) and the International Electrotechnical Commission (IEC). It sets out requirements for establishing, implementing, maintaining, and continually improving an information security management system (ISMS). Ensuring the confidentiality, integrity, and availability of organizational information assets, obtaining an ISO 27001 certificate means that the enterprise has passed the audit conducted by a certification body, proving that its information security management system has met the requirements of the international standard.

ISO 13485 certificate

ISO 13485 is an internationally recognized standard for Quality Management Systems (QMS) specifically tailored for the medical device industry. It outlines the requirements for organizations involved in the design, development, production, installation, and servicing of medical devices, ensuring they consistently meet regulatory requirements and customer needs. Essentially, it's a framework for medical device companies to build and maintain robust QMS processes, ultimately enhancing patient safety and device quality.
